I have Hawkeye Total which would work on the 3 Landys. It is true that it will only do new keys unless you have a used key with the long bar code. Other than that it will do everything you need for the Landys. It will not work with the BMW. Nanocom will program used keys with just the short code inside the fob but is only good for 1 platform without buying additional licences and the the initial cost is about $80 more than Hawkeye, Bang for the buck in your case would be the Hawkeye IMO. But the BMW would be left out unfortunately,
I’ve got a Nanocom Evo and Foxwell NT510 (now NT520).
With the Foxwell ($155) I had Jaguar/Land Rover diagnostics and added BMW diagnostics for another $70 for my wife’s 2011 X5. It works very good.
